On Fri, Sep 11, 2009 at 04:02:07PM +1000, Peter Hutterer wrote: > As previously mentioned, I created a git supermodule for X11R7.5. It is now > in a usable state. > > http://cgit.freedesktop.org/~whot/X11R7.5/ > > The supermodule starting point was X11R7.4. It includes modules listed in > build.sh, with dependencies outside the xorg/ tree in a directory called > extras (xcb, mesa, pixman). > > Some modules removed since 7.4 have been removed from the supermodule, other > modules have been updated to their latest released version. > > With the release of the server snapshot last week the module is now > up-to-date and everything builds against each other (tested on F-11 > tinderbox without any system X and GL headers installed).
Correction: mesa breaks building progs/glsl.
